Northeast Metro (Line 736) Transmission Line Rebuild Project

Project Overview

Xcel Energy is proposing the rebuilding of Line 736 from Taylors Falls to the Arden Hills substation. A multiple phase project running through the counties of Chisago, Washington, Anoka and Ramsey, the Northeast Metro Rebuild project is designed to strengthen Xcel Energy’s transmission infrastructure and continue to meet electrical demand in the region.

The current 69kV line has reached the end of its expected operational life and requires new poles and wiring in order to maintain reliability and safety requirements. Additionally, substations along the route will be updated and a substation (Birch) in Shoreview will be relocated and rebuilt.

The rebuild will leverage the current line route and construction will take place in the existing easements.  The route will be divided into three phases – Taylors Falls to Scandia, Scandia to Hugo, and Hugo to Arden Hills. Construction is anticipated to begin in Fall 2025 and will be conducted in phases beginning with the Taylors Falls to Scandia segment.

Project Details

Phase I Details
Phase I of the project will be focused rebuilding on a section of the line from Taylors Falls to Scandia. The rebuild will leverage the existing line route and easements. Located in an area with heightened wildfires risk, Xcel Energy will be replacing the existing wooden structures with 50-foot steel poles (approximately 10 feet taller to meet current standards). The construction process will begin with clearing vegetation and then laying mats in preparation for pole replacement and rewiring.

Project Timeline

  • Filing the Route Permit application with the Minnesota Public Utilities Commission: Early 2025
  • Phase I: Anticipated construction to begin: August 2025
  • Phase II: Anticipated construction to begin: January 2026
  • Phase III (Hugo to Birch): Anticipated construction to begin: January 2027
  • Target completion date for construction: Late 2027
